### Summit rugged and beautiful Hunter Mountain in the Catskills with great views, plus a dip at the stunning Diamond Notch Falls
A Catskills favorite, Hunter Mountain offers multiple viewpoints, incredible evergreen forests, and panoramic views from the summit fire tower. We'll also check out the historic ranger’s cabin at the summit. After our descent down the mountain, we'll cool off with a well-earned dip in the stunning Diamond Notch Falls then visit the renowned Westkill Brewery for post-hike brews and snacks.
### Hike stats
🥾 9.1 miles from Diamond Notch Falls parking area to the Hunter Mountain summit and back
⛰️ About 1940 ft elevation gain with some steep and scrambly sections
🧭 Difficulty: Challenging### The Destination Backcountry Difference
